I am attorney Laura Anthony founding partner of Legal Compliance, a full service corporate, securities, and business transactions law firm. Today is the continuation in a series of LawCasts discussing What is a security? In the last LawCast I talked about the Howey Test for determining when an investment contract is a security. The Howey Test has been applied to find that many non-traditional investments are a security. So, for instance, in a later case, the court found that sale of shares in a housing cooperative that were bundled with the cost of an apartment to be used as a residence, and where the co-op income is used for common operating expenses and upkeep of the building, there was not a securities transaction, even though it was the sale of shares in the co-op where the investors were attracted solely by the prospect of acquiring a place to live, and not by financial returns on their investment. Market risk benefits defined. FASB has defined market risk benefits as follows: A contract or contract feature that both provides protection to the contract holder from capital market risk and exposes the insurance entity to other-than-nominal capital market risk should be recognized as a market risk benefit.
Features that meet the definition of MRBs are accounted for at fair value. The portion of the fair value change attributable to a change in the instrument-specific credit risk of the issued contract is recognized in other comprehensive income, while the remainder is recognized in net income.
The initial measurement of an equity method investment should include the cost of the investment itself and all direct transaction costs incurred by the investor in order to acquire the investment.

Entities can define the change in fair value attributable to instrument-specific credit risk as the excess of the total change in fair value over the change in fair value attributable to changes in a base market rate, such as a risk-free rate.
The market risk benefit (MRB) is an amount that a policyholder receives in addition to the account balance upon the occurrence of a specific event or circumstance, such as death, annuitization, or periodic withdrawal that involves protection from capital market risk.
Investment contracts are those contracts written by an insurer that do not subject the insurer to docHub mortality or morbidity risk (e.g., a guaranteed investment contract (GIC)).
A long-duration insurance contract is one that generally is not subject to unilateral changes in its provisions and either provides insurance coverage or a return for an extended period.
